refactor: Cambiada la estructura de las controladoras

This commit is contained in:
2024-08-11 18:21:15 -03:00
parent 11bd93e016
commit 5673d60e4f
11 changed files with 67 additions and 86 deletions

View File

@@ -4,9 +4,9 @@ using Modelo;
namespace Controladora
{
public class ControladoraOrdenDeCompras : ControladoraBase<OrdenDeCompra, ControladoraOrdenDeCompras>
public class ControladoraOrdenDeCompras : Singleton<ControladoraOrdenDeCompras>
{
public override string Añadir(OrdenDeCompra t)
public string Añadir(OrdenDeCompra t)
{
if (t == null) return "El OrdenDeCompra es nulo fallo la carga";
if (t.Proveedor == null) return "No se cargo el proveedor";
@@ -19,6 +19,7 @@ namespace Controladora
$"Fallo la carga del OrdenDeCompra {t.Id}";
}
<<<<<<< HEAD
private bool ProductoCheck(ReadOnlyCollection<DetalleOrdenDeCompra> ldetalles)
{
bool ret = false;
@@ -32,6 +33,9 @@ namespace Controladora
return ret;
}
override public string Eliminar(OrdenDeCompra t)
=======
public string Eliminar(OrdenDeCompra t)
>>>>>>> 675d86f (refactor: Cambiada la estructura de las controladoras)
{
if (t == null) return "El OrdenDeCompra es nulo fallo la carga";
@@ -40,7 +44,7 @@ namespace Controladora
$"Fallo la Eliminacion del OrdenDeCompra {t.Id}";
}
override public string Modificar(OrdenDeCompra t)
public string Modificar(OrdenDeCompra t)
{
if (t == null) return "El OrdenDeCompra es nulo fallo la carga";
@@ -49,7 +53,7 @@ namespace Controladora
$"Fallo la Modificacion del OrdenDeCompra {t.Id}";
}
public override ReadOnlyCollection<OrdenDeCompra> Listar()
public ReadOnlyCollection<OrdenDeCompra> Listar()
{
return RepositorioOrdenDeCompra.Instance.Listar();
}